Speichern von variablen in externer Datei

Snipero

Mitglied
Hallo Leute,
ich habe in meinem Programm ca. 350 variablen (verdammt viel für mich ;-))
die man durch eine inputbox ändern kann und alle in Labels ausgegeben werden.
So, man sollte die ganzen variablen aber abspeichern können (damit man nicht ständig alle daten neu eingaben muss).

Wie kann ich das am einfachsten realisieren. Bin nämlich noch ein "Newbie". :rolleyes:
Die Daten sollen überschrieben werden können gelesen und gespeichert werden...

Was für einen Dateityp bzw. Datenbabnkentyp sollte ich da nehmen?

Ich bedanke mich schon im Vorraus!
MFG:
Snipero2
 
Hallo Snipero,

bestimmt ist jemand schneller als ich!
Also du solltest dir mal einige Tutorials zum Schreiben in Dateien anschauen. Schau mal unter: VB-Archiv

Dein Problem lässt sich realtiv einfach lösen:
Code:
Kanal = FreeFile 'Freie "Speichertür" wir gesucht
Open "C:\Variablen.txt" for append as Kanal 'Der Appendmodus schreibt und überschreibt Dateien
line input #Kanal, Variable1, Variable2,... 'hier kommen deine Variablen rein
'------------Hier kannst du deine Variablen aus der Datei laden und neue bestimmen---------
Text1.text = Variable1 'Variable lesen
Variable1 = Text1.text 'Neue Variable bestimmen
'-------------Am Schluss muss der Kanal geschlossen werden!----------------------------------------
close Kanal ' Simpel, oder?

Du musst nicht "Kanal" schreiben, du kannst auch "FreieDateinummerdieeigentlichüberhauptnichtwichtigfürmichist" schreiben.
Anstatt "C:\Variablen.txt", kannst du auch eine Variable, die den Dateipfad enthält, angeben. Du musst natürlich nicht nur TXT-Dateien speichern, du kannst auch DAT, ANNA, SNIPERO, oder was auch immer für Dateien speichern - aber nur im Append-Modus!

Viel Spaß:
Da' Hacker
 
Zurück